Aftermath - Free Parking
Clear the Archives Building of Enemies
Take cover behind the large steel barricade just in front of you and make this your operations base as you target the enemies to the left, right, and some snipers on the balcony above. If you have the sniper rifle, now's a good time to make use of it. Also, instead of peeking around the corner, sometimes it's best to back a foot or two away from the wall and target the enemies without using the cover system--this will give you a greater vantage point while keeping you out of view of the snipers. Once most of the enemies are down, two flamethrowing-equipped baddies will start heading your way: One from the left, the other from the right. They're slow, but you should try to kill them quickly to ensure they don't get close.
Once the area's cleared, you have the choice of entering the Archive via an entryway on the left and right. The right route is quite a bit easier, both due to the room's layout, but also since Dom will be at your side.
-Left Route
Be careful as you enter the first room, as it contains both a flamethrower and a sniper. Keep back in either corner and try to take them down from here; retreat outside if you need to regain health. After killing both, push forward to a box just before the next room and use it for cover--move up to the box ahead to target the enemies that descend the stairs on the right. And watch out for tickers! Once clear, head through the door.
-Right Route
Be careful as you enter the first room, as it contains both a flamethrower and a sniper. Climb the stairs afterward and take cover by the railing to target the enemies in the room below, but be ready for a couple of tickers to find their way up to you. Once clear, head down the stairs and through the door.
Secure the Courtyard
Back outside, grab some ammo from the left, then take cover behind the railing on the extended section of the balcony and target the foes from here. You may have to head into the courtyard to trigger some more foes, then quickly retreat back to your point of cover. Prepare for a few Mauler Boomers and Blood Mounts to come your way. When finished, enter the hall on the far side and turn the wheels to raise the gate and continue.
Proceed Down Cooper Street
Run down the stairs and take cover at the first concrete barrier. Once clear, check for some grenades up another staircase to the left, and some ammo near a barrier. As you pass through a fence, look for a Jacinto Sentinel Newspaper behind a barrier to the right. Soon after, you'll be given the choice of two paths: Streets or Garage. The latter is, by far, the easier of the two.
-Streets
Take cover behind the first concret barrier, then shoot a large gas cannister alongside the left building to kill all the enemies inside. Run there and take cover by the windows to tackle the enemies further up the street. Afterward, step a foot or two outside to trigger a Reaver, than dash back inside. Chill here until the Reaver takes off of his own accord. Now you may want to start working your way up the street, car to car, until you reach another concrete barrier. Take cover and then target another gas cannister by the parking garage to kill most of the enemies ahead.
-Garage
Look for some ammo upstairs, then prepare to take cover behind the first concrete barrier as you enter the garage proper. Take down the enemies on the other side of the chain link fence, then hop the barrier on the left and push the car if you want to give your partner some cover below. Now work your way to the back and climb down the ramp to regroup with Dom.
After regrouping, take cover and prepare for some enemies to jump a barricade on the left, then get ready for a Grinder ahead. Take cover at the car just before the corner to target a few more drones, then stay here as you battle a Reaver--so long as you don't move, he won't be able to get at you. Afterward, take cover by the nearby concrete barrier to target the remaining stragglers, then push forward up the street. After passing through a destroyed building, check inside a small room on the left for a CoG Tag.
